fix CURRNET (fix build)

This commit is contained in:
Егор
2025-02-05 10:18:18 +00:00
committed by GitHub
parent 11280877d4
commit 56cb3b1e84
2 changed files with 10 additions and 10 deletions

View File

@@ -14,4 +14,5 @@
".vscode-insiders", ".vscode-insiders",
"package/DEBIAN" "package/DEBIAN"
], ],
"cmake.parallelJobs": 1
} }

View File

@@ -16,25 +16,25 @@ add_custom_target(
W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R} W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R}
COMMENT "Download libraries" COMMENT "Download libraries"
BYPRODUCTS BYPRODUCTS
${CMAKE_CURRNET_BINARY_DIR}/lib ${CMAKE_CURRENT_BINARY_DIR}/lib
${CMAKE_CURRNET_BINARY_DIR}/sdk-28-10-16.7z ${CMAKE_CURRENT_BINARY_DIR}/sdk-28-10-16.7z
) )
add_custom_target( add_custom_target(
archive_libraries archive_libraries
COMMAND 7z a lib.7z ${CMAKE_CURRNET_BINARY_DIR}/lib COMMAND 7z a ${CMAKE_CURRENT_BINARY_DIR}/lib.7z ${CMAKE_CURRENT_BINARY_DIR}/lib
WORKING_DIRECTORY ${CMAKE_CURRNET_BINARY_DIR} W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R}
BYPRODUCTS BYPRODUCTS
${CMAKE_CURRNET_BINARY_DIR}/lib.7z ${CMAKE_CURRENT_BINARY_DIR}/lib.7z
DEPENDS DEPENDS
${CMAKE_CURRNET_BINARY_DIR}/lib ${CMAKE_CURRENT_BINARY_DIR}/lib
) )
add_custom_target( add_custom_target(
download_linux download_linux
COMMAND wget http://ftp.kolibrios.org/users/Serge/new/Toolchain/x86_64-linux-kos32-5.4.0.7z -q -O ${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z COMMAND wget http://ftp.kolibrios.org/users/Serge/new/Toolchain/x86_64-linux-kos32-5.4.0.7z -q -O ${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z
COMMAND wget http://board.kolibrios.org/download/file.php?id=8301libisl.so.10.2.2.7z -q -O 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2.7z COMMAND wget http://board.kolibrios.org/download/file.php?id=8301libisl.so.10.2.2.7z -q -O 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2.7z
W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R} WORKING_DIRECTORY ${c}
COMMENT "Download linux toolchain" COMMENT "Download linux toolchain"
BYPRODUCTS BYPRODUCTS
${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z ${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z
@@ -53,7 +53,7 @@ add_custom_target(
add_custom_target( add_custom_target(
extract_linux extract_linux
COMMENT "Extract linux archives" COMMENT "Extract linux archives"
COMMAND 7z x 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2.7z COMMAND 7z x -y 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2.7z
W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R} W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R}
BYPRODUCTS BYPRODUCTS
${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2 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2
@@ -81,7 +81,6 @@ add_custom_target(
COMMAND cp -f 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2 ${CMAKE_CURRENT_BINARY_DIR}/package/usr/lib/x86_64-linux-gnu/libisl.so.10.2.2 COMMAND cp -f 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2 ${CMAKE_CURRENT_BINARY_DIR}/package/usr/lib/x86_64-linux-gnu/libisl.so.10.2.2
COMMAND cp -f ${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z ${CMAKE_CURRENT_BINARY_DIR}/package/home/autobuild/tools COMMAND cp -f ${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z ${CMAKE_CURRENT_BINARY_DIR}/package/home/autobuild/tools
COMMAND cp -f ${CMAKE_CURRENT_BINARY_DIR}/lib.7z ${CMAKE_CURRENT_BINARY_DIR}/package/home/autobuild/tools COMMAND cp -f ${CMAKE_CURRENT_BINARY_DIR}/lib.7z ${CMAKE_CURRENT_BINARY_DIR}/package/home/autobuild/tools
COMMAND cp -f ${CMAKE_CURRNET_BINARY_DIR}/lib.7z ${CMAKE_CURRENT_BINARY_DIR}/package/home/autobuild/tools
COMMAND dpkg-deb --build ${CMAKE_CURRENT_BINARY_DIR}/package ${CMAKE_CURRENT_BINARY_DIR}/package.deb COMMAND dpkg-deb --build ${CMAKE_CURRENT_BINARY_DIR}/package ${CMAKE_CURRENT_BINARY_DIR}/package.deb
W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R} WORKING_DIRECTORY ${CMAKE_CURRENT_BINARY_DIR}
COMMENT "Build deb offline package" COMMENT "Build deb offline package"
@@ -90,7 +89,7 @@ add_custom_target(
DEPENDS DEPENDS
${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2.7z ${CMAKE_CURRENT_BINARY_DIR}/libisl.so.10.2.2.7z
${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z ${CMAKE_CURRENT_BINARY_DIR}/kos32-toolchain-linux.7z
${CMAKE_CURRNET_BINARY_DIR}/lib.7z ${CMAKE_CURRENT_BINARY_DIR}/lib.7z
) )
add_custom_target( add_custom_target(